The Strokes, known for their gritty embrace of garage rock revival, often weave intricate tales through their music, exposing the undercurrents of human emotions and societal observations. ’50/50,’ a compelling track from their fifth studio album ‘Comedown Machine,’ serves as a raw confrontation with the inner workings of personal judgment and the dichotomies we face.

Through a seemingly straightforward progression, the lyrics unravel a complex narrative that begs for a deeper analysis. This exploration will unearth the various layers present in ’50/50,’ dissecting both the explicit messages and the latent thematic cores interlaced within the track.

A Battle with Judgment: Defiance in the Face of Critique

The track kicks off with an unflinching challenge to the status quo, painting a vivid backdrop where the protagonist is exposed to unsolicited life stories and prejudgments. The repeated entreaty, ‘I will say, “Don’t judge me,”‘ is both a plea and an assertion of identity, a line in the sand drawn against societal pressures and the weight of others’ expectations.

This battle cry against judgment strikes a universal chord, echoing across the experiences of anyone who has felt the sting of being misunderstood or unfairly categorized. It’s a call to arms for self-acceptance and a denouncement of unwarranted condemnation.

Metaphors of Confinement: The Prison of Our Own Making

The motif of taking ‘all the prisoners inside’ is a stark metaphor for self-imprisonment through harboring grudges, regrets, and resentments. The song suggests a figurative self-confinement that occurs when one clings to the destructive elements of their past or present.

By juxtaposing the act of throwing wisdom ‘in the fire,’ The Strokes cast these prisoners in a transformative light. This destruction is not just an end, but a possible pathway to liberation—a theme consistently present in the band’s work where the destruction of the old paves the way for the new.

The Meaning Behind the Fire: Destruction as Catharsis

The imagery of fire conveys both the potential for destruction and the hope for regeneration. The ‘wisdom in the fire’ alludes to the invaluable lessons that often only emerge through the searing trials of existence. It’s a purifying force, incinerating the chaff of life’s less desirable episodes to reveal the fundamental truths that lie beneath.

In this light, ’50/50′ is not just about the duality of chance but also the duality of experience—the inevitable pain and the possible growth that can arise from it.

Memorable Lines: The Pendulum Between Light and Shadow

‘I wait on a darkened highway’ is a line that etches itself into the listener’s consciousness, serving as a reminder of the anticipation and uncertainty that infuse the human condition. The ‘darkened highway’ represents the unknown paths we traverse, the unpredictable landscapes that shape who we are and who we become.

This line resonates with the sense of stasis that can grip us during challenging times, reinforcing the theme of waiting in life’s ambiguous spaces, hopeful for illumination but often engulfed in darkness.

The Song’s Hidden Meaning: A Dive into the 50/50 Nature of Living

Beyond the visage of casual rock, ’50/50′ cuts to the heart of the duality that accompanies every aspect of existence. Within the song, ’50/50′ transcends statistical chance and instead comments on the equilibrium between loss and gain, between holding on and letting go.

It’s in this delicate balance that The Strokes capture a snapshot of the human experience, wrapped in the guise of a rock anthem. The track serves as a stark reminder that life, in its essence, is a series of gambles, where stakes are high, but the potential for redemption is always within reach.
